Q: Is 2,008,402 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,008,402 is a composite number.

Why is 2,008,402 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,008,402 can be evenly divided by 1 2 11 22 91,291 182,582 1,004,201 and 2,008,402, with no remainder.

Since 2,008,402 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,008,402, it is a composite number.
